SARAJEVO, October 19 (FENA) – Thirty years after the signing of the Dayton Peace Agreement, Annex IX, which envisions the establishment of public corporations and the integration of key infrastructure sectors in Bosnia and Herzegovina, remains largely unimplemented. Known as the 'Agreement on the Establishment of Public Corporations in Bosnia and Herzegovina', it was designed to enable joint management of transport, energy, communications, and utility services, beyond the jurisdiction of the entities.
